Cross Country Education is seeking a proactive, engaged High School Math Teacher for the '25-'26 school year. If you are an educator who stays ahead of the curve, thrives in a collaborative 'powerhouse' setting, and is eager to make a tangible impact on 9-12th graders, join us in transforming education in New York City, NY ! Position Overview: Deliver engaging, high-quality mathematics instruction to students in grades 9–12, tailoring lesson plans to meet diverse learning needs and foster academic growth. Manage daily classroom operations and curriculum implementation with the initiative to address student needs and classroom challenges independently. Actively participate in staff meetings and department collaborations, contributing to a cohesive team environment and the school mission. Facilitate daily office hours (3:30 pm – 4:00 pm) to provide one-on-one tutoring, clarify complex concepts, and offer personalized academic guidance.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ree (Required)
  • Valid New York City Teaching Certificate (Preferred)
  • Alternatively: Non-Certified candidates must hold a minimum of 12 credits in Mathematics and provide an official transcript
  • 1-2 years of teaching experience within high school mathematics, with a proven track record of conveying complex subject matter
